Start with your product characteristics
Before comparing machine models, define exactly what you are packing. This is the most important step because the filling principle, material contact parts, dust control, pumping method, and seal design all depend on product behavior.
Questions to ask about the product
- Is the product a powder, granule, liquid, paste, gel, or mixed material?
- Does it flow freely or bridge easily?
- Is it dusty, sticky, corrosive, oily, or foamy?
- Does it require high filling accuracy?
- Is it sensitive to moisture, oxygen, or contamination?
- Does it contain solid particles in liquid?
For example, free-flowing granules may work well with multi-head weighers or cup fillers, while fine powders often require auger fillers and dust extraction. Liquids and sauces may need piston pumps, servo pumps, or specialized nozzles to avoid dripping and splashing.
Match the machine to the pouch type
Not all premade pouch filling machines handle all pouch styles equally well. Your pouch dimensions, zipper design, gusset structure, and material thickness affect how the pouch is picked up, opened, filled, and sealed.
| Pouch Type | Typical Applications | Machine Considerations |
|---|---|---|
| Stand-up pouch | Snacks, powders, pet food, supplements | Stable pouch opening and accurate pouch positioning |
| Flat pouch | Powders, tablets, small-dose products | Compact handling and clean sealing area |
| Zipper pouch | Resealable food and consumer goods | Reliable zipper opening and top seal quality |
| Spouted pouch | Liquids, puree, gels | Specialized filling station and nozzle alignment |
| Gusset pouch | Coffee, grains, bulk dry products | Stronger pouch support and shape control |
Always send pouch samples to the machine supplier for real testing. This is the fastest way to verify opening rate, filling stability, sealing strength, and finished package appearance.

Define the production speed you actually need
Speed should be based on realistic operating conditions, not only the maximum speed shown in catalogs. In actual production, output depends on pouch size, product characteristics, fill volume, operator skill, changeover frequency, and downstream coordination.
Evaluate speed using these points
- Target output per minute, hour, and shift
- Expected uptime during a normal production day
- How often you switch pouch sizes or products
- Whether inspection, coding, cartoning, or case packing is included
- Future production growth over the next 2–5 years
A machine that is slightly larger than your current demand can give useful room for growth. However, an oversized machine may create unnecessary capital cost and reduce efficiency if your product range changes frequently.
Check filling accuracy and sealing quality
Packaging efficiency is not only about speed. If pouches are poorly sealed or fill weights are inconsistent, your real productivity falls due to rework, scrap, and customer complaints.
Look for a premade pouch filling machine that offers:
- Stable dosing system matched to product type
- Consistent pouch opening to reduce missed fills
- Clean filling area to prevent product on seal zones
- Reliable heat sealing control for your pouch material
- Quality rejection function for unqualified packs
Common quality issues to prevent
- Powder trapped in the sealing area
- Liquid dripping after filling
- Inconsistent vacuum opening of pouches
- Wrinkled or weak top seals
- Weight variation beyond tolerance
Consider hygiene, cleaning, and material standards
If you package food, pharmaceuticals, health supplements, or cosmetics, hygiene design is essential. The machine should be easy to clean, resistant to corrosion, and built with suitable contact materials such as stainless steel where required.
| Factor | Why It Matters | What to Check |
|---|---|---|
| Contact materials | Protects product safety | Food-grade or pharma-appropriate stainless steel parts |
| Cleanability | Reduces contamination risk | Quick disassembly and low dead-angle design |
| Dust or spill control | Improves sealing and workshop cleanliness | Dust covers, suction, drip-proof nozzles |
| Validation support | Important for regulated industries | Documentation, testing, and traceability support |
Assess machine flexibility for multiple products
Many factories do not package just one SKU. If you run multiple pouch sizes or product types, flexibility can be more valuable than peak speed. A machine with easier adjustments may save more money over time than a faster but rigid system.
Important flexibility features include:
- Fast recipe changes through HMI
- Simple pouch width and height adjustment
- Tool-free or low-tool changeover design
- Compatibility with different fillers
- Optional coding, nitrogen flushing, zipper opening, or checkweighing modules
Look beyond the standalone machine
Efficient packaging operations depend on the complete workflow, not just the filling machine itself. A premade pouch filler should work smoothly with upstream feeding systems and downstream inspection or packing equipment.
Typical line components
- Product feeder or elevator
- Auger filler, weigher, piston filler, or pump system
- Premade pouch feeding and opening section
- Sealing and cooling stations
- Date coder or printer
- Checkweigher, metal detector, or vision inspection
- Cartoning, case packing, and palletizing equipment
If your business plans to automate more steps later, choose equipment that can be integrated into a broader packaging line. Evaluate ease of operation and maintenance
A machine that is difficult to operate can reduce efficiency even if it has strong technical specifications. Operators should be able to understand alarms, adjust settings, perform basic cleaning, and complete routine maintenance without excessive downtime.
What operators and maintenance teams need
- User-friendly touchscreen interface
- Clear alarm messages and troubleshooting prompts
- Accessible wear parts and maintenance points
- Stable electrical and pneumatic components
- Spare parts availability and remote support
Ask suppliers how long common spare parts take to ship, what documentation is included, and whether online technical support is available after installation.
